Olga Kurylenko and Liana Liberato Join THE EXPATRIATE

Actresses join Aaron Eckhart in CIA action thriller.

Philipp Stölzl’s spy thriller ‘The Expatriate’ has found its female leads in Olga Kurylenko (‘Quantum of Solace’) and Liana Liberato (‘Trust’).

According to Variety, Bond girl Kurylenko will play “a CIA agent assigned to track down her former CIA partner and lover (Aaron Eckhart).” Additionally, Liana Liberato has been cast as Eckhart’s daughter.

The movie is currently filming in Montreal with production set to move to Brussels in May.

Based on an original screenplay by A.E. Amel, the film follows a former CIA agent who hopes to make a fresh start with his estranged 15-year old daughter. He takes a job in Belgium as a security expert for a multinational corporation and arrives one day to find the corporation no longer exists, his co-workers are gone, and his assistant is really a trained operative out to kill him and his daughter. Father and daughter go on the run and must learn to trust each other, something that becomes difficult once she learns the truth about his shadowy past.
